About Julio Iglesias

Julio Iglesias, born on September 23, 1943, in Madrid, Spain, is one of the most influential figures in Latin music. His journey into the world of music started at a young age when he won a local singing contest in 1962, which granted him a contract to record an album with Hispavox Records. His musical career took off after moving to Mexico City in 1968, where he released his first major hit, "El Amor", which became a huge success throughout Latin America. This marked the beginning of his ascent into global fame. In 1970, he moved to the United States and signed with CBS International, releasing the album "Yodo, Yodo" that same year. Iglesias's breakthrough in the English-speaking world came with the release of his self-titled album in 1974, which included hit singles like "To All the Girls I've Loved Before," "Begin the Beguine," and "Can't Help Falling in Love." These songs catapulted him to international stardom. Throughout his career, Iglesias has sold over 300 million records worldwide, making him one of the best-selling Spanish artists of all time. His influences range from Nat King Cole and Frank Sinatra to Plácido Domingo and Andrés Segovia. Iglesias's music, characterized by his powerful tenor voice and romantic ballads, has been a constant in the hearts of listeners for decades. He continues to perform worldwide and is an enduring symbol of Spanish culture in the global music scene.

Interpretations of Popular Quotes

"The secret of life is enjoying the passage of time."

The quote by Julio Iglesias, "The secret of life is enjoying the passage of time," implies that finding joy in each moment as it passes is a fundamental aspect of living a fulfilling life. It encourages us to appreciate time not just as a series of events or achievements, but as an ongoing experience filled with moments of happiness and contentment. This perspective can help reduce stress, increase mindfulness, and foster a greater sense of gratitude for the journey of life itself.


"Music is the diplomat in an otherwise impolite world."

This quote by Julio Iglesias suggests that music has a unique ability to transcend cultural, linguistic, and social barriers that often divide people. It serves as a common language, allowing individuals from diverse backgrounds to connect and communicate with each other in a peaceful and harmonious way, even when other forms of interaction might be strained or difficult. Music acts as a diplomat by fostering understanding, empathy, and unity among people, contributing positively to the world's social climate.
